Root Operation Definition

Extraction: Pulling or stripping out or off all or a portion of a body part by the use of force.

Questions About This Page

How many billable codes are in the 0DD range?

Of the 71 codes in this range, 70 are billable and valid for inpatient claim submission from October 1, 2025 through September 30, 2026. Table header codes group them but cannot be reported on claims.

What does the 0DD range classify?

The range classifies Extraction procedures, pulling or stripping out or off all or a portion of a body part by the use of force, performed on the gastrointestinal system. Each code adds the body part, approach, device, and qualifier in characters four through seven, and links to its own reference page.
